alright, havent had a mustang in over a year
about to pick up an '02 gt with 56,000 miles on it tomorrow.

the owner has a few mods done, but only weld in flowmaster 40's.


when i got my old gt, it had the stock h pipe installed but the cats cut out and straight pipes in its place.

i'm wanting to get a new o/r h pipe for the car, but almost all the brands i see for H pipes list them for only 96-98. i see X pipes for 96-04, and of course the prochamber, but i cant find an hpipe that i know anything about.


anyone have any suggestions?

all the h pipes are the same, all headers and mid pipes for all year 2v's are interchangable.
